Kylian Mbappé Back in Training with Bandaged Nose Ahead of Euro 2024

In a significant development from the European Championship, France's football sensation Kylian Mbappé made his first public appearance since sustaining a facial injury, returning to light training with a noticeable bandage over his broken nose. This update comes amidst growing speculation about the duration of Mbappé's absence from the field following a collision that left him with a bloody and swollen nose during France's 1-0 victory against Austria.

Mbappé Trains with Bandaged Nose

Mbappé's resilience was hinted at in a cryptic Instagram post stating, "Without risks, there are no victories," reflecting his determination. Despite the injury, the forward, set to join Real Madrid, was seen engaging in practice sessions at the Home Deluxe Arena in Paderborn, indicating a possible return to the game sooner than anticipated.

Adrien Rabiot and William Saliba, Mbappé's teammates, shared encouraging updates on his condition. Rabiot drew parallels between Mbappé's injury and that of Juventus goalkeeper Wojciech Szczesny, who returned to play shortly after a similar incident. "A fractured nose isn't the end of the world," Rabiot conveyed through a translator, suggesting Mbappé's quick comeback.

Saliba also reported a positive shift in Mbappé's condition, noting improvement and further tests to assess his readiness for upcoming matches. France's next challenge is against the Netherlands on Friday, with official confirmation on Mbappé's participation still pending.

Impact on Team Strategy

The potential absence of Mbappé, who serves as a pivotal figure and captain for the French team, poses strategic challenges. However, Rabiot expressed confidence in the team's depth and ability to adapt without their star player. Options like Olivier Giroud and Randal Kolo Muani are available to fill the void left by Mbappé's potential absence.

Mbappé's injury occurred during a clash with Austria defender Kevin Danso, leading to immediate concern over his ability to continue in the tournament. Despite this setback, the forward's participation in training activities suggests a strong possibility of his return to play, especially as France eyes progress into the knockout stages of Euro 2024.

With France not scheduled to play its round of 16 match before June 30, there remains time for Mbappé to recover fully. The team and fans alike hold onto hope for his swift return, recognizing his crucial role in France's quest for European glory.
